Things to do with kids: Summer Camp Open Houses: NYC Day Camps, Commuter Camps and Sleepaway Camps

The very first phone call I got in 2013 was from a fellow mom asking me if I had any summer camp recommendations. I was impressed. Usually Summer Camp Freak Out Fever doesn't kick in until early February. But with many summer programs already holding open houses and putting those countdown to summer clocks on their websites, no wonder we're all stressing out.

While it will be a few weeks before we finish overhauling our Mommmy Poppins Summer Camp Guide for 2013, we decided to share info about upcoming open houses and tours of some of our favorite NYC day camps, commuter camps and a couple of sleepaway camps. Our list is by no means comprehensive—there are hundreds of summer camps in Manhattan alone! But these are all quality programs that we either have personal experience with (my seven-year-old can vouch for TADA! and Oasis Central Park and Mommy Poppins founder Anna loves Buck's Rock), or boast top-notch reputations.

If you're interested in a camp but can't attend the open house for some reason, it's worth calling or emailing to see if there will be alternate dates. In addition to the individual programs listed, we've got the scoop on a series of local camp fairs where you can meet representatives from multiple programs at once. So let your research begin!

Camp Fairs in NYC

Every year, the American Camp Association and New York Family magazine organize a series of Camp Fairs in Manhattan and Brooklyn where families can meet representatives from more than 60 summer programs. These events are free and take place on select dates through early April. Visit NY Fam's website for a list of dates and locations, and participating summer camps. RSVP recommended.

Got a child with special needs? NYC-based nonprofit Resources for Children with Special Needs hosts its annual free Special Camp Fair on Saturday, January 26 11am-3pm, where you can learn about 70 programs. Visit the website for more info.
